[Detailed description of the invention] (Industrial application field) This invention relates to building panels.

(Prior Art) In general, building panels are connected in the width direction by fitting one end 3 and the other end 4 of adjacent panel materials A and A, as shown in Fig. 3. It's hot,
The other end 4 of the other panel material A is in contact with the back of one end of one panel material A, and a hook-shaped piece 5 provided at one end 3 of one panel material A is connected to the continuous joint. needs to extend to the back of the other end of the other panel material A, and the hook-shaped piece 5 needs to be fixed to the base material 6 with screws.

However, in the above-mentioned continuous connection, rainwater enters the contact area 8 between the back of one end of the panel A and the other end 4 with capillary action. Further, the rainwater passes through the gap B between the hook-shaped piece 5 and the other end 4 and from the screw-fastened part of the hook-shaped piece 5 to the base material 6.
It has the disadvantage of easily penetrating into the body.

(Purpose of the invention) This invention addresses the drawbacks of the above-mentioned conventional examples and aims to improve the preventive properties of such building panels.

(Example) Hereinafter, the basic structure of this invention will be explained based on FIG. The small piece 7 is a screw that fixes the hook-shaped piece 5 to the base material 6. The panel materials A are made of aluminum, and these panel materials A are connected in the width direction to form the exterior walls, ceiling, etc. of the building.

At the tip of the other end 4 which is in contact with the back surface of the first end 3, there is a first water section 9 which is expanded to have a cross-section. between the contact surfaces 8
This prevents rainwater from entering the panel from the contact surface 8 between the small piece 11 of one end 3 and the other end 4 by breaking the capillary phenomenon of rainwater that occurs. That is, the concave groove formed in the first water section 9 is directed inward (upward in FIG. 1).
Therefore, even if rainwater sprayed from the outside to the inside, that is, from the bottom to the top in FIG. There is no risk of the water flowing further into the interior beyond the grooves of the section 9, and flows down along the grooves. Therefore, there is no fear that rainwater will enter inside the other end 4, that is, into the upper gap B in FIG. In particular, as mentioned above, the capillarity of rainwater that occurs in the contact pipe 8 is cut off by the concave groove in the first water section 9, even if the capillarity occurs in the contact pipe 8 and rainwater is sucked in from the outside. This is because they are stored inside the tank and flowed down.

Further, even a small amount of rainwater that has entered the gap B between the other end 4 and the hook-shaped piece 5 from the contact surface 8 is returned by the second water section 10. That is, the second water section 10
prevents rainwater from entering the gap B from entering the base material 6 through the screw fixing hole of the screw 7.

At the other end (the right end in FIG. 2) of the second water section 10, which is located on the right in FIG. A packing 12 made of a waterproof material such as rubber is fixed to the base material 6 together with the hook-shaped piece 5 by screws 7. The free end portion of this packing 12, that is, the lower end portion in FIG. .
In this way, waterproof packing 1 is attached to the back side of the other end 4.
2, and this second water section 1
The watertightness of panel material A is increased by one layer and panel material A,
Earthquake resistance between A and A can be improved.

Moreover, according to the configuration of the present invention shown in FIG.
That is, it is arranged on the left side in FIG.
Rainwater that has entered the left side of the figure can be collected in the groove of the first water section 9 and flowed down. This makes it possible to block almost all of the rainwater that crosses the first water segment 9 and enters further inward. Furthermore, the packing 12 can also block rainwater that has entered the gap B beyond the first water section 9. Therefore, it is possible to reliably block rainwater from entering from the outside toward the inside, and high sealing performance can be achieved. Moreover, since the gasket 12 is provided closer to one end of the other panel material A than the second water section 10, rainwater that has entered the gap B does not adhere to the gasket 12, which prevents deterioration due to adhesion of rainwater. The panel material A can be elastically supported for a long period of time, thereby improving durability.

(Effects of the invention) As described above, according to the building panel of this invention, rainwater is drained by the double structure of the first water section and the second water section, so that such a building This has the effect of increasing the waterproofness of the panel.

In particular, according to the present invention, the first water intercept is provided closer to the other end of one panel material than the small piece, thereby blocking rainwater flowing through between the other end of the other panel material and the small piece. can do. Moreover, since the second water cutter is provided with a seal,
Even if rainwater flows further into the interior beyond the first water section, it can be reliably blocked by this packing. As described above, in the present invention, high sealing performance can be achieved by the first and second water sections and the packing. Furthermore, since the seal is located closer to one end of the front panel material than the second water cutter, even if rainwater that cannot be blocked by the first water cutter further intrudes into the interior, the seal will almost never be blocked. Rainwater does not adhere to it, and therefore it is possible to prevent deterioration due to adhering rainwater and improve durability. As a result, rainwater can be blocked for a long period of time, and in particular, it is possible to resiliently resist pressure from the outside, and the anti-vibration effect can be maintained for a long period of time.
